8th Annual Mod of the Year Awards

Ever since studios like ID Software started making development tools freely available to the public, the modding community has become a hotbed for the sort of creativity that we rarely see in the mainstream.

One thing the two have in common is that the complexity and sophistication of mods has kept pace with the mainstream. While in the early days a mod was simply a map and custom audio pack for a game, the total conversion mods of the current times can be considered a game in itself.

Sites like ModDB are trying to bring some order to the anarchic and chaotic world of independent game development. Apart from working as an impressive repository of mods, the website also hosts annual awards to recognize some of the best works.

Here are the winners of the 8th Annual Mod of the Year Awards.


Out of Hell [Unreal Tournament 2004]

Winner, Best Original Art Direction [Editor's Choice]
Nominated, Best Single-player Mod [Editor's Choice]


Out of Hell is a single-player mod for Unreal Tournament 2004 created by a solitary developer. In a time when Zombie mods are a dime a dozen, this mod manages to stick out due to impressive level design and also some of its design choices. Gameplay is more challenging than the norm, and there is steady pace and tension throughout the single-player experience.

MechWarrior: Living Legends [Crysis]

Winner, Best Multiplayer Mod [Editor's Choice]
Winner, Mod of the Year [Player's Choice]


This one is a total-conversion multiplayer mod for the Crysis, which brings back memories of MechWarrior. Along with the Mechs, players can pilot aircrafts and control ground vehicles like tanks, while engaging in team-based faction vs. Faction battles with up to 32 players on a single server. This mod features destructible vegetation, day-night cycles and all the other goodness that comes with CryENGINE 2.

The Nameless Mod [Deus Ex]

Winner, Best Single-player Mod [Editor's Choice]
Nominated, Mod of the Year [Player's Choice]

The Nameless Mod is based on Warren Spector's classic cyber-punk action RPG, Deus Ex. The mods premise is not too far off from the original classic, based in a futuristic, fictional city called Forum City. True to its name, the social and civic system of the city is based on the structure of discussion boards found on the internet. The player's part in the story is to uncover the mystery behind the recent spate of Moderator's disappearances. Boasting 59 levels, 20 weapons, spoken conversation, cinematic and an original background score - among other things-The Nameless Mod is a game and a half in itself.

Aaaaa! --A Reckless Disregard for Gravity

Winner, Best Indie Game [Editor's Choice]

This game is a spin-off on the sport base jumping and is set in an urban landscape. Players score points depending on things like - speed of the fall and the distance from buildings as you take the plunge. Bonus points can be scored by giving the spectators the thumbs-up or flipping on your way down. Aaaaa! has also been nominated for Excellence in Design at this year's Independent Game Festival and it is available with all popular digital distribution systems for USD 9.95.

Natural Selection 2

Winner, Indie Game of the year [Player's Choice]

Natural Selection 2 has the unusual distinction of being selected as the winner of this award even before the final release of the game. A sequel to Natural Selection, which was a mod based on the Source engine, Natural Selection 2 is a stand-alone game designed on a brand new engine designed by the developers. The game is a FPS that pits groups of marines against the alien hive and the final release will come bundled with tools to create custom maps and scenarios.
